Bulgaria saw a significant increase in keratometer import shipments in 2024, with Japan, USA, Germany, Switzerland, and South Korea emerging as the top exporting countries. The Market Top 5 Importing Countries and Market Competition (HHI) Analysis displayed a rapid growth rate, with a remarkable Compound Annual Growth Rate (CAGR) of 43.4% from 2020 to 2024. The Herfindahl-Hirschman Index (HHI) indicated a shift from low concentration in 2023 to very high concentration in 2024, highlighting a more consolidated Market Top 5 Importing Countries and Market Competition (HHI) Analysis landscape. This data suggests a strong demand for keratometers in Bulgaria and a competitive Market Top 5 Importing Countries and Market Competition (HHI) Analysis environment dominated by key exporting nations.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
